Tar roof repair services involve inspecting and restoring flat or low-slope roofs that are covered with tar-based materials. These roofs typically consist of layers of asphalt, tar, or bitumen, which are applied in multiple coats to create a waterproof barrier. The repair process may include patching damaged areas, sealing cracks, replacing deteriorated sections, and ensuring the overall integrity of the roofing system.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and materials to address issues efficiently, helping to extend the lifespan of the roof and prevent further damage.
This service is essential for resolving common problems such as leaks, blistering, cracking, and pooling water. Over time, exposure to the elements can cause the tar surface to degrade, leading to vulnerabilities that allow water infiltration.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ent structural damage to the property, reduce the risk of mold growth, and avoid costly repairs down the line. The overview below groups typical Tar Roof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- minor fixes like patching leaks or replacing damaged shingles typically cost between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the damage and material costs.
Moderate Repairs - more extensive work such as replacing sections of the roof or addressing multiple leaks can range from $600 to $2,000. These projects are common and usually involve a larger scope of work.
Full Roof Replacement - replacing an entire tar roof generally costs between $3,000 and $7,000, with larger or more complex projects reaching higher amounts. Many local contractors handle projects in this range, though larger jobs can exceed it.
Complex or Large-Scale Projects - extensive or custom installations, such as adding insulation or structural modifications, can surpass $10,000. These are less common and typically involve specialized services from experienced contractors.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What signs indicate a tar roof needs repair? Common signs include visible cracks, blisters, ponding water, or leaks inside the building. If these issues are present, it may be time to consult local contractors for an assessment.
Can tar roof repairs extend the roof's lifespan? Yes, proper repairs can help address damage and prevent further deterioration, potentially extending the roof’s useful life when handled by experienced service providers.
What types of repairs do tar roof specialists typically perform? They often fix cracks, blisters, ponding areas, and leaks, as well as perform surface resealing and patching to restore the roof’s integrity.
Are tar roof repairs suitable for all types of buildings? Tar roof repairs are generally suitable for flat or low-slope roofs commonly found on commercial and some residential buildings, but a local contractor can assess specific needs.
